Fullerton, California --- Fullerton Police Department released body camera, drone and surveillance camera footage of an officer involved shooting that occurred on Tuesday March 26, 2024 at a Fargo bank during a bank robbery.
Police said, on Tuesday March 26, 2024 at approximately 5:09 p.m., the Fullerton Police Department dispatch Center received a 911 call from an employee at the Wells Fargo Bank located at 141 West Bastanchury Road.
The employee explained that a man later identified as 57 years old Scott Thompson
was in the bank claiming to have a bomb and demanding money.
At the time, the bank was open and there were employees and a customer inside the business.
The first officer arrived at the bank within 2 minutes of the call being dispatched and began coordinating the response of additional personnel and resources.
Additional officers arrived and established a containment perimeter around the bank.
An officer was able to make contact with an employee in the bank via telephone.
That employee was able to provide updates regarding Thompson's actions and explained Thompson was sitting at a desk and they were going to give him the money he demanded.
About 10 minutes into the incident the employee told the officer the bank personnel would be
placing $58,000 in a box with DPS written on it and Thompson would be walking out of the bank shortly after.
Thompson exited the bank holding a white box and began walking away from the bank
doors, officers immediately gave him commands to put his hands up and to stop.
Thompson failed to follow the instructions he was given and instead turned around and started walking back towards the bank doors. Police said, fearing Thompson may be re-entering the bank
with an explosive device and as he neared the bank doors an officer involved shooting occurred.
Immediately after the officer involved shooting, officers began to approach Thompson to take him into custody and render Medical Aid, however because Thompson indicated he had an explosive device they secured the area and requested the assistance of the Orange County bomb squad.
The Orange County Sheriff's Department Hazardous Devices Section is made up of 18 members and averages 600 to 800 requests for service yearly, which include rendering safe 50 to 80 improvised explosive devices each year.
The Orange County bomb squad responded and used a tactical robot to examine the device and was determined to be an item constructed to resemble an actual explosive device, referred to as a facsimile device also known as a Fax.
Thompson was pronounced deceased at the scene once it was rendered safe by the Orange County bomb squad.
Police said that Scott Thompson had an extensive criminal history and was on federal probation for armed bank robbery at the time of this incident. Furthermore, he had prior federal convictions for armed bank robbery and escape. And a state conviction for robbery.
